My son turns 2 in November and I'm due my second then.

Should I wing it without a second buggy or go for the second buggy?!

I didn't bother with a second buggy but DS was a really strong walker by 2 and I drive so never really needed it

Does your son still nap in the day? My did do, well over 3yo, so I would've been stuck indoors for part of the day. Maybe you could consider a sling? That would give you options (baby in sling, son in pushchair when required)?

My son's 2.5 and I find the buggy really useful for keeping him contained when he's being difficult, and for getting somewhere faster when he won't walk. I would hate to be dealing with a newborn and have my 2 year old running off.

Could you find a cheap double buggy on marketplace? My friend has one for her 3.5 and 2 year olds and it's really handy.

We had a similar age gap and no way could I have coped without a double. Needed them both strapped in and safe for shops, roads etc. My older one always liked the buggy though and sat nicely in it.

I had the same age gap and used a double for about a year. I couldn’t have coped without it. I think it depends on the personality of the child. Mine liked to throw tantrums and refuse to walk or run off when he was that age so for my own sanity he needed strapping in. We also walked a lot.

Depends on whether you regularly walk long distances, or if you’re more of a car / into shop / back in car kind of person

I never got one, bought a buggy board instead but we didn't even use that. I drive too so i didn't use the buggy much for anything but leisurely walks and my eldest would use his scooter

Really depends on your lifestyle
